About the job

Google isn't just a software company. The Hardware Operations team is responsible for monitoring the state-of-the-art physical infrastructure behind Google's powerful search technology. As an Operations Technician, you'll install, configure, test, troubleshoot and maintain hardware (like servers and its components) and server software (like Google's Linux cluster). You'll also take on the configuration of more complex components such as networks, routers, hubs, bridges, switches and networking protocols. You'll participate in or lead small project teams on larger installations and develop project contingency plans. A typical day involves manual movement and installation of racks, and while it can sometimes be physically demanding, you are excited to work with infrastructure that is at the cutting-edge of computer technology.

In this role, you'll deploy and maintain Google's Data Center Server and Network Infrastructure by installing, configuring, testing, troubleshooting, and repairing hardware and server software. You'll manage the configuration of networks, routers, bridges, and switches. You'll lead local project teams on installations and develop project contingency plans. You will manage the physical deployment of data center-related technology and partner with various stakeholders. You will ensure that goals, missions, and projects are successfully delivered and that they are repeatable across our global array of data centers.

Responsibilities

  • Participate in complex troubleshooting and resolve critical technical issues.
  • Install and maintain switches, routers, and other large-scale networking gear.
  • Configure and troubleshoot Linux OS-related issues.
  • Test and troubleshoot new server and network hardware components and designs.
  • Contribute to efforts/projects in the deployment, maintenance, and support of current and new data center infrastructure.
